What is Computer-Assisted Semen Analysis?

CASA is an advanced laboratory technique used to evaluate the quality of semen. It uses sophisticated software and imaging systems to analyze sperm characteristics like concentration, motility (movement), morphology (shape), and vitality. Unlike manual semen analysis, which relies on the technician’s observation, CASA offers an objective and consistent approach, minimizing human error.

How Does CASA Work?

The process of CASA is straightforward yet highly effective. Here’s a step-by-step breakdown:

  1. Sample Collection: The first step involves collecting a semen sample, typically through masturbation, in a sterile container. It’s important that the sample is collected after 2-5 days of abstinence for the most accurate results.
  2. Preparation: The semen sample is then prepared for analysis. This might involve liquefying the semen or diluting it, depending on the laboratory’s protocol.
  3. Microscopic Examination: The prepared sample is placed under a microscope attached to a computer. The CASA software captures high-resolution images of the sperm.
  4. Analysis: The software analyzes the images, assessing sperm count, motility, morphology, and more. This data is processed to generate a comprehensive report.
  5. Results Interpretation: The detailed report provides insights into your sperm quality, which your doctor will use to guide further treatment or lifestyle recommendations.

Why Choose CASA?

CASA offers several advantages over traditional semen analysis:

  • Accuracy: CASA provides precise measurements, reducing the variability and subjectivity common in manual analysis.
  • Comprehensive Data: The software can analyze thousands of sperm cells in a single sample, offering a more detailed picture of your fertility.
  • Time-Efficient: Results are generated quickly, allowing for faster diagnosis and treatment planning.
  • Improved Fertility Treatments: CASA is particularly beneficial for tailoring fertility treatments like IVF, as it helps in selecting the healthiest sperm for fertilization.

Practical Tips for Optimizing Your Semen Analysis

Whether you’re undergoing a manual semen analysis or CASA, there are several ways you can prepare to ensure the most accurate results:

  1. Abstain for 2-5 Days: To get a representative sample, avoid ejaculation for at least two days but not more than five days before your test.
  2. Stay Hydrated: Drink plenty of water in the days leading up to your test. Hydration can affect the volume and consistency of your semen.
  3. Avoid Heat Exposure: High temperatures can negatively impact sperm quality. Avoid hot tubs, saunas, or placing laptops on your lap for extended periods.
  4. Maintain a Healthy Diet: A diet rich in antioxidants (found in fruits and vegetables) can improve sperm quality. Consider incorporating foods like berries, nuts, and leafy greens into your meals.
  5. Manage Stress: High stress levels can affect hormone balance and sperm production. Engage in stress-relief activities like yoga, meditation, or regular exercise.
